Nanogram to Gigatonne Conversion Formula

One nanogram is equal to 1e-24 gigatonne.

Manual Calculation to Convert 6 ng to gigatonne

To convert 6 nanogram to gigatonne, multiply the value by the conversion factor: 1e-24. As one nanogram is equal to 1e-24 gigatonne, therefore,

6 ng x 1e-24 = 6e-24 gigatonne

So, 6 nanogram = 6e-24 gigatonne
